Configuring NIC Mode

Note: This setting is only available when SR-IOV is enabled, Personality is set to

“NIC”, and a two-port OCe14000-series adapter is in use.

This setting allows you to control the VF count on a two-port OCe14000-series adapter.

The choices include:

NIC – the VF count is restricted to 31 VFs per port and QoS is supported for

those VFs.

NIC-ETS Disabled – the VF count is set to 63 VFs per port but QoS is not

supported for those VFs.

To select the NIC Mode:
1. From the Configure Controller screen (Figure 3-5), ensure that the NIC personality

is selected and SR-IOV is enabled.

2. Use the up or down arrow keys to select NIC Mode.
3. Use the left or right arrow keys to select the desired setting and press <Enter>.
4. Press <F7> to save.

Loading Default Settings

If you want to erase the current configuration, from the Configure Controller screen

press <F8>.
See “Erasing Ports and Controller Configuration” on page 1546 for more information.

Selecting a Port

Once you have set the options in the Configure Controller screen, ensure that you have

saved your changes. To save the current settings, press <F7>.
To proceed to the Port Selection menu:
1. From the Configure Controller screen, press <F6>. The Port Selection Menu

appears.

Figure 3-6 Port Selection Menu

Note: The Port Selection Menu only appears if there are two or more ports

connected.
